Description

UPDATE: Added a new version that's easier to print, requires less cleanup and supports, and allows access to the SD card.

I also added a version adjusted for the OLED Nintendo Switch, available here: https://www.printables.com/model/413917-nintendo-switch-handles-oled-version

Update: Added a version that can be docked without removing the grips.

I created this because I didn't love any of the existing designs. One has seams, screw holes, and etc. that I didn't care for. Another two piece would allow the actual switch unit to fall out the bottom of the grips if you weren't careful. So I designed this that basically combined ideas from each design that I did like.

This will fit on a 250 mm print bed if it is turned to the diagonal.

After confirming the original print was what I wanted and everything fit correctly, I split the model in 2 for smaller print beds. I haven't tested the 2 piece print but it should have enough tolerance on a well tuned printer so that the pieces have a snug fit (but not too tight or too loose). If anyone does do that 2 piece print let me know if anything needs changed.

For the two piece print I would orient the pieces as shown in the 4th (green) image with supports and at least a 5mm brim.

Print instructions

I printed this upright with a 5mm brim as well as supports. It will require a bit of post print cleanup. That will mostly consist of just smoothing what was printed on supports.
